Mid-Level Full-Stack Developer
Job description
TEAM Integrated Omics
REPORTING TO Lead of the Integrated Omics Team
This position will focus on developing and maintaining web applications.
Responsibilities include implementing user interfaces, building secure and scalable back-end APIs, integrating data from NetSuite ERP and other 3rd party services, engaging in system architecture design, and assisting in enhancing the NetSuite ERP system.
Develop Web Applications
❖ Design and implement user-friendly interfaces with NextJS or ReactJS.
❖ Build secure, reliable, and scalable back-end APIs in Python.
❖ Perform thorough testing and debugging to identify and resolve software defects, ensuring the delivery of high-quality, bug-free code.
❖ Integrate NetSuite data with in-house web applications.
❖ Engage in requirements analysis, system design, and software architecture discussions to provide technical expertise and make informed decisions.
❖ Maintain documentation for system configurations, customizations,
and integrations.
Assist in Enhancing the NetSuite ERP System
❖ Contribute to the customization, automation, and enhancement of the NetSuite ERP system of Zymo Research (using JavaScript).
Job requirements
ESSENTIAL QUALIFICATIONS
❖ Bachelor’s degree in Computer Science, Information Technology, or related fields.
❖ Familiarity with CSS, JavaScript and Python; 2+ years’ experience of using JavaScript or Python in professional projects.
❖ Experience with integrating database systems to back-end web services.
❖ Excellent problem-solving skills and attention to detail.
❖ Eagerness to learn and adapt to new technologies and programming environments.
❖ Strong communication and interpersonal skills in cross-cultural settings.
❖ Ability to work independently and as part of a team.
❖ Experience with project management and change management.
❖ English: moderate proficiency.
PREFERRED QUALIFICATIONS
❖ Familiarity with FastAPI and NextJS (or ReactJS).
❖ Experience with cloud platforms (e.g., AWS, Azure, Google Cloud) and
deploying applications using containerization technologies (Docker, Kubernetes).
❖ Familiarity with automated testing frameworks (e.g., Jest, PyTest) and continuous integration/continuous deployment (CI/CD) pipelines.
❖ Experience in database management and querying.
❖ Exposure to graph databases and GraphQL
❖ Any exposure to SuiteScript in a NetSuite ERP system (even as a learner).
SALARY &BENEFITS To be discussed during the interview.
What We Can Offer
Bonus
❖ Annual salary appraisal
Paid Leave
❖ Annual Health Checkup
❖ Annual Travel (domestic or international)
❖ Free lunch one time per week
❖ Party on celebration for welcome/birthday/farewell,…
❖ Coffee + Snacks (available) at the office
Others
❖ 12+ days of paid leave per year
❖ Vietnam Social Insurance (full salary)
Job Information
08/11/2024
Experienced (non-manager)
Information Technology/Telecommunications > Software Developer
JavaScript, ReactJS, Python, NextJs
Chemical/Biochemical
English
3
Not shown
Job Locations
District 3, Ho Chi Minh City, Vietnam
457-459A Nguyễn Đình Chiểu, phường 05, quận 3, thành phố Hồ Chí Minh, Việt Nam
(View map)Scam detection